Share via


TimezoneURL class

Um TimezoneURL representa um URL para as operações de fuso horário Azure Maps.

Extends

Construtores

TimezoneURL(Pipeline, string)

Cria uma instância de TimezoneURL.

Propriedades Herdadas

mapsUrl

Valor da cadeia de URL base.

Métodos

getTimezoneByCoordinates(Aborter, GeoJSON.Position, GetTimezoneByCoordinatesOptions)

Esta API devolve informações atuais, históricas e futuras de fuso horário para um par de latitude-longitude especificado. Além disso, a API fornece horas de pôr-do-sol e nascer do sol para uma determinada localização. Utiliza a API Obter Fuso Horário Por Coordenadas: https://docs.microsoft.com/rest/api/maps/timezone/gettimezonebycoordinates

getTimezoneById(Aborter, string, GetTimezoneByIdOptions)

Esta API devolve informações atuais, históricas e futuras de fuso horário para o ID de fuso horário IANA especificado. Utiliza a API Obter Fuso Horário por ID: https://docs.microsoft.com/rest/api/maps/timezone/gettimezonebyid

Métodos Herdados

newPipeline(Credential, INewPipelineOptions)

Um método estático utilizado para criar um novo objeto pipeline com credenciais fornecidas.

Detalhes do Construtor

TimezoneURL(Pipeline, string)

Cria uma instância de TimezoneURL.

new TimezoneURL(pipeline: Pipeline, mapsUrl?: string)

Parâmetros

pipeline
Pipeline

Chame MapsURL.newPipeline() para criar um pipeline predefinido ou fornecer um pipeline personalizado.

mapsUrl

string

Uma cadeia de URL que aponta para Azure Maps serviço, a predefinição é "https://atlas.microsoft.com". Se não for especificado nenhum protocolo, por exemplo "atlas.microsoft.com", será https assumido.

Detalhes da Propriedade Herdada

mapsUrl

Valor da cadeia de URL base.

mapsUrl: string

Valor de Propriedade

string

Herdado deMapsURL.mapsUrl

Detalhes de Método

getTimezoneByCoordinates(Aborter, GeoJSON.Position, GetTimezoneByCoordinatesOptions)

Esta API devolve informações atuais, históricas e futuras de fuso horário para um par de latitude-longitude especificado. Além disso, a API fornece horas de pôr-do-sol e nascer do sol para uma determinada localização. Utiliza a API Obter Fuso Horário Por Coordenadas: https://docs.microsoft.com/rest/api/maps/timezone/gettimezonebycoordinates

function getTimezoneByCoordinates(aborter: Aborter, coordinate: GeoJSON.Position, options?: GetTimezoneByCoordinatesOptions): Promise<GetTimezoneByCoordinatesResponse>

Parâmetros

aborter
Aborter
coordinate
GeoJSON.Position

Coordenadas do ponto para o qual são pedidas informações de fuso horário. A consulta aplicável é especificada como uma cadeia separada por vírgulas composta pela latitude seguida de longitude, por exemplo, "47.641268,-122.125679".

Devoluções

getTimezoneById(Aborter, string, GetTimezoneByIdOptions)

Esta API devolve informações atuais, históricas e futuras de fuso horário para o ID de fuso horário IANA especificado. Utiliza a API Obter Fuso Horário por ID: https://docs.microsoft.com/rest/api/maps/timezone/gettimezonebyid

function getTimezoneById(aborter: Aborter, id: string, options?: GetTimezoneByIdOptions): Promise<GetTimezoneByIdResponse>

Parâmetros

aborter
Aborter
id

string

O ID do fuso horário da IANA.

Devoluções

Detalhes do Método Herdado

newPipeline(Credential, INewPipelineOptions)

Um método estático utilizado para criar um novo objeto pipeline com credenciais fornecidas.

static function newPipeline(credential: Credential, pipelineOptions?: INewPipelineOptions): Pipeline

Parâmetros

credential
Credential

Como SubscriptionKeyCredential, TokenCredential e MapControlCredential.

pipelineOptions
INewPipelineOptions

Devoluções

Um novo objeto pipeline.

Herdado deMapsURL.newPipeline